Not sure about how force_new_session() will be used, but probably Self::rotate_session(normal_rotation && !broken_validation, is_final_block) would be better (to make sure we slash validators)?

Copy link
Member Author

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

the idea is that if you use force_new_session(), then it is able to override everything else in terms of the slashing.

if force_new_session() isn't the reason that this session is ending, then slashing is done if this session has been prematurely ended.
